摘要
试验研究了铅含量对灰铸铁组织、性能、冶金质量指标的影响以及铅在灰铸铁中的微观分布。结果表明,当含铅量小于0.005%时,灰铸铁具有较好的力学性能和冶金质量指标,而当含铅量大于0.005%时,力学性能和冶金质量指标明显下降,同时灰铸铁的断面敏感性增大,并强烈地改变铸铁的石墨形态,同时有促进渗碳体析出的趋势。因此灰铸铁中的含铅量应控制在0.005%以下。
In this experiment have been studied the effects of Pb on structures,properties、metallurgical quality index, andmicro-distribution of Pb.The results shows that when the content of Pb is lower than 0.005%,the mechanical properties and metallurgical quality index are better. However when the content of Pb is larger than 0.005%,the mechanical properties and metallurgical quality index are decline.The minor lead element which is added to the gray iron can make not only the raise of section sensitivity,but also the change of graphite shape.Besides,it can improve the precipitate tendency of cementite,it has been suggested that Pb content must belimited to<0.005%.
